Mist Output

One of the most important features to consider is the mist output of the humidifier. This is measured in milliliters per hour (ml/h) and determines how much moisture the humidifier can add to the air. The higher the mist output, the faster the humidifier can increase the humidity level in a room.

For small rooms like bedrooms or offices, a mist output of 200 - 300 ml/h should be sufficient. However, if you have a larger room or a dry environment, you might want to look for a humidifier with a mist output of 400 ml/h or more. Tank Capacity

Another crucial feature is the tank capacity. This refers to how much water the humidifier can hold at one time. A larger tank capacity means you won't have to refill the humidifier as often, which is especially convenient if you're using it in a large room or for an extended period.

If you plan to use the humidifier overnight or in a large area, look for a tank capacity of at least 3 - 5 liters. Humidity Control

Humidity control is an essential feature that allows you to set the desired humidity level in the room. Most modern ultrasonic humidifiers come with a built - in hygrometer that measures the current humidity and adjusts the mist output accordingly.

This feature is great because it helps maintain a consistent humidity level, which is not only more comfortable but also healthier. For example, a humidity level between 40% - 60% is considered ideal for most indoor environments. Safety Features

Safety should always be a top priority when choosing any home appliance. Ultrasonic humidifiers have several safety features that you should look out for.

One important safety feature is the automatic shut - off function. This feature turns off the humidifier when the water level in the tank gets too low, preventing the device from running dry and potentially causing damage. Additional Features

Some ultrasonic humidifiers come with additional features that can enhance their functionality and convenience.

  • Multiple Mist Modes: Some models offer different mist modes, such as low, medium, and high. This allows you to adjust the mist output according to your needs. For example, you might want to use the low mist mode at night or in a small room, and the high mist mode during the day or in a larger space.
  • Aroma Diffuser: An aroma diffuser feature allows you to add essential oils to the water tank, filling the room with a pleasant scent while humidifying the air. This can have a relaxing and therapeutic effect, making your space more enjoyable.
  • Remote Control: A remote control makes it easy to adjust the settings of the humidifier from a distance. You can turn it on or off, change the mist mode, or adjust the humidity level without getting up from your seat.

Air Purification

If you're concerned about air quality, you might want to consider an Air Purifier Humidifier. These devices not only humidify the air but also filter out dust, pollen, and other airborne particles.

They usually come with a built - in air filter that traps impurities as the air passes through the humidifier. This can be especially beneficial for people with allergies or respiratory problems, as it helps improve the air quality in the room.
